***Please read this review if you are planning to repurchase this product, or buy it based on pre-existing reviews.
Recently DDF repackaged this product in a new bottle. Previously it was packaged in a plain white plastic pump bottle. The new packaging features a new pump style bottle in a cylinder shape. However, IT IS NOT THE SAME PRODUCT.
I had been using this product for a few months with success as it is a very gentle product. I went to repurchase as I have many times and came across the new packaging. I asked the SA at Sephora if it had been reformulated and was assured that it was the EXACT same product it has always been. So I bought it because the ingredients listed on the back matched the ones on the box from my previous bottle of Ultra Lite Oil-Free Moisturizing Dew. I'm a cautious person though and have many problems with my sensitive skin. So I contacted DDF through their website asking for specifics regarding the new packaging. I wanted to know if ANYTHING at all had been changed in the formula. In a few days the company responded with this:
"Yes, we have made some minor changes to the Ultra Lite Oil-Free Moisturizing Dew. Some modifications have been made to create an even better version of our popular moisturizer. However, we think you will find this new formula to be very close to the original."
So I pumped a few drops onto my hand side by side with the original. The original has a more transparent gel appearance while the new version seemed only slightly more opaque and milky white. It seemed thicker too, but minimally so. The scent and consistency were very close, so I decided to try it on my face. Within a few minutes my entire face was bright red and burning. I've only ever had such a severe reaction with highly perfumed products. I cannot account for the reaction at all. But it happened and I have swollen skin and a sunburn-like effect all over my face, even after thoroughly washing my face.
So I contacted DDF by phone this afternoon and the representative said that they'd been receiving many complaints and similar problems from their customers because of the new reformulation but they could offer me no further details about the new product. They did offer me a full refund, but this does nothing to reverse the problem my skin is having to this new formula. Also, they wouldn't give any reasons why they would change a product that they've had a clear success with for many years. Also, they said that the representatives at retailers such as Sephora and Nordstrom's should NOT be telling their customers that this is the same formula as the original Ultra Lite Oil Free Moisturizing Dew because it is absolutely not the same product.
I only wanted to recount my experience in case other people were going to repurchase thinking that it was the exact same product that they had been buying in the past. Please use caution when trying the new formula.
